## Authentication

The Merganser dedup service merges duplicate customer records nightly, so every API call that reads or writes match candidates must be authenticated. Reviewers should confirm that the client attaches credentials before the merge-preview call, and that unauthenticated requests fail closed with a 401. For local verification against the staging cluster, authenticate using the bearer token below:

portal login ticket: eyJhbGciOiJIUzI1NiIsInR5cCI6IkpXVCJ9.eyJzdWIiOiIwEOsktwVNwIn0.-UJU3fdyyCgG

**Ticket QV-Sweeper: Vault locked after sweeper run**

The Grimsell orphaned-resource sweeper flagged the staging credentials vault as unreferenced and revoked its lease, so the vault auto-sealed at 03:12. Sweeper allowlist has been patched to exclude vault leases going forward. On-call needs to unseal the vault manually from the Petrel admin console so downstream jobs can resume. The unseal prompt will accept the phrase below.

vault phrase of yagag-kadup = belael-druius-rusax-kelox

Capacity note: Fabrikker test-data factory. Plugin authors: generated fixture pools are shared per worker, not per plugin. Oversized batch requests get queued, not rejected, so memory pressure shows up late. Keep trait expansion shallow; deep nesting multiplies object counts fast. Budget roughly 2MB per thousand records. The constants below govern pool sizing and eviction; override them only in isolated suites.

constants for bawif-kawif:
QUOTAS = {
    "ulaael": 5,
    "holael": 10,
}

**Mgmt Meeting Minutes — Retiring the Brightline Range**

Quick recap for sales leads at Fenholt Supplies: we agreed to retire the Brightline fixture range by year-end. Remaining stock moves to clearance pricing next month, and accounts on standing orders get migrated to the Lumetta range. Trade-in incentives were approved in principle. The confidential note on next steps sits just below.

board note of bajof-bajeg: The pricing group signed off on a budget of $13.4 million for Project Sildor. The renewal with Lamixek Holdings closes at $48.9 million a year, 49 percent above the last contract.